      Jeanette Pearce Several meds cause dry eyes/reduced tear production, which would increase their acidity, and several meds interact with Riluzole, some often taken by people with MND, and may cause such a side effect as acidic tears.

      But... I also have a theory 🤔 Riluzole inhibits glutamate processes, glutamate is found in normal tears but not so much in dry eyes, so maybe this affects the pH of tears.

      If it's bothersome, maybe artificial tears would dilute the acidity and make for more comfortable eyes?
